From d52005ab2b813753c3e2206fd4dbc8dcae7e9852 Mon Sep 17 00:00:00 2001
From: Philipp Spitzer
Date: Wed, 4 Jul 2018 21:06:26 +0200
Subject: [PATCH 1/1] Format air temperature and time values in template.
---
web/seepark_web.py | 1 -
web/templates/seepark_web.html | 4 ++--
2 files changed, 2 insertions(+), 3 deletions(-)
diff --git a/web/seepark_web.py b/web/seepark_web.py
index c0fd440..3ca0b51 100644
--- a/web/seepark_web.py
+++ b/web/seepark_web.py
@@ -188,7 +188,6 @@ def data(timespan):
@app.route("/")
def index():
airvalue, airtime = currentairtemperature(apikey, cityid)
- airvalue = "{:.1f}".format(airvalue) if isinstance(airvalue, float) else airvalue
watervalue, watertime = currentwatertemperature('0316a21383ff') # config? mainwatertemp?
watervalue = "{:.1f}".format(watervalue) if isinstance(watervalue, float) else watervalue
diff --git a/web/templates/seepark_web.html b/web/templates/seepark_web.html
index 7715013..2fccfd6 100644
--- a/web/templates/seepark_web.html
+++ b/web/templates/seepark_web.html
@@ -29,8 +29,8 @@
{% if airvalue is none %}
Luft: N/A
{% else %}
- Luft: {{ airvalue }}°C
- ({{ airtime }})
+ Luft: {{ airvalue|round(1) }}°C
+ ({{ airtime.strftime('%Y-%m-%d %H:%M') }})
{% endif %}
--
2.47.3